
10 Essential Features Every Small Business Website Needs to Succeed
Adam Lee | Published on November 17, 2024
A well-designed website is critical for small businesses looking to attract customers, establish credibility, and drive growth. But what makes a website truly effective? To stand out and convert visitors into loyal customers, your website must include key features that enhance user experience, functionality, and performance. Here are 10 essential features every small business website needs to succeed.
Table of Contents
1. Clear and Professional Branding
Your website is often the first impression customers have of your business. Strong branding helps you stand out and build trust.
Key Elements:
- A clean logo prominently displayed at the top of the site.
- Consistent color schemes and fonts that reflect your brand identity.
- A clear tagline or value proposition on the homepage.
2. Mobile-Friendly Design
With over half of web traffic coming from mobile devices, having a mobile-optimized site is a must.
Why It Matters:
- Improves user experience for smartphone and tablet visitors.
- Boosts SEO rankings, as search engines favor mobile-responsive sites.
- Increases conversion rates by ensuring smooth navigation on any device.
3. Easy-to-Navigate Menu
A simple, intuitive navigation menu helps visitors find what they’re looking for quickly.
Best Practices:
- Use clear labels for menu items like "About Us," "Services," "Contact," and "Shop."
- Keep the menu visible across all pages.
- Include a search bar for larger websites or e-commerce stores.
4. Fast Loading Speed
Slow websites can frustrate visitors and drive them away. A speedy website keeps them engaged and improves SEO.
Optimization Tips:
- Compress images before uploading.
- Use a reliable hosting provider.
- Minimize unnecessary plugins or scripts.
5. Contact Information
Make it easy for customers to get in touch with you.
Must-Have Details:
- Phone number, email address, and physical address (if applicable).
- A contact form for quick inquiries.
- Links to social media profiles for alternative communication channels.
6. Call-to-Action (CTA) Buttons
Guide visitors toward taking the next step with clear CTAs.
Examples of Effective CTAs:
- "Book a Consultation" for service providers.
- "Shop Now" for e-commerce stores.
- "Sign Up for Our Newsletter" to build an email list.
7. Customer Testimonials and Reviews
Showcasing positive feedback builds credibility and trust in your brand.
How to Display Testimonials:
- Create a dedicated testimonials page.
- Highlight key quotes on the homepage or services pages.
- Include reviews with customer photos for added authenticity.
8. About Us Page
An "About Us" page helps visitors understand your story, mission, and values.
What to Include:
- A brief history of your business.
- Information about your team or leadership.
- Photos of your staff or workspace to add a personal touch.
9. SEO Basics
Search engine optimization (SEO) ensures your website can be found by potential customers on Google and other search engines.
Essential SEO Practices:
- Add meta titles and descriptions to each page.
- Use alt text for images.
- Research and integrate relevant keywords throughout your content.
10. Secure Website (SSL Certificate)
A secure website protects user data and builds trust with visitors.
What to Look For:
- An SSL certificate ensures your site uses "https://" and displays a padlock icon in browsers.
- Secure payment gateways for e-commerce sites.
- Regular updates to plugins and software to prevent vulnerabilities.
Bonus Tip: Integrate Analytics Tools
Use tools like Google Analytics to track visitor behavior, measure performance, and identify areas for improvement.
Conclusion
Your small business website is more than just a digital storefront—it’s a powerful tool for growth. By incorporating these 10 essential features, you can create a professional, functional, and customer-friendly site that sets your business apart.
If you’re ready to build or enhance your small business website, Grand Rapids IT Solutions is here to help. Our team specializes in creating stunning, high-performing websites tailored to your unique needs.
Contact us today to start building your success online!
Find More Website Tips Like These
Browse related blogs we'll think you'll like below.

Website Tips
5 Common Website Mistakes That Could Be Costing Your Business Customers
Your website is the digital storefront of your business. It’s often the first interaction potential customers have with your brand, and first impressions matter. A poorly designed or maintained website can turn visitors away, costing your business valuable leads and revenue. To help you avoid this, we’ve compiled a list of 5 common website mistakes that could be driving customers away—and how to fix them.

Social Media Marketing
The Best Social Media Platform for Your Business: A Complete Guide to Making the Right Choice
Choosing the best social media platform for your business can be overwhelming, but it doesn’t have to be. Each platform serves a unique purpose and caters to different audiences. In this blog, we explore the strengths of top platforms like Facebook, Instagram, LinkedIn, TikTok, Twitter, and Pinterest, helping you match your business goals with the right online space. Whether you’re targeting professionals, creative minds, or the next generation of consumers, this guide offers actionable insights to maximize your social media strategy. Read on to find out where your business should focus to thrive online!

Marketing
Perfect Timing: The 2025 Guide to Boosting Social Media Engagement
Maximize your social media engagement in 2025 by mastering the art of timing. This comprehensive guide explores why posting at the right time matters, platform-specific trends, and how to discover the optimal posting schedule for your unique audience. Learn actionable strategies, from analyzing data and experimenting with timing to leveraging scheduling tools like Hootsuite and Buffer. With insights tailored for platforms like Instagram, TikTok, LinkedIn, and more, you’ll gain the knowledge to boost visibility, engagement, and ROI. Discover the perfect posting schedule and take your social media strategy to the next level!

Marketing
How Local Businesses Can Thrive Online: 5 Essential Steps
A strong online presence is the key to success for local businesses in the digital era. This guide walks you through five essential steps to boost your visibility and connect with your audience online. Learn how to craft a user-friendly website, harness the power of local SEO, engage your community through social media, create impactful content, and use analytics to refine your strategy. Whether you’re a coffee shop or an IT service provider, these practical tips will help you attract customers, build trust, and stand out in a competitive marketplace.
Need Help With Your Website?
That's what we do best! Schedule a free call today and let's get started growing your business.